Every nationality can get a visa at the desk without applying first, and a large number of them pay nothing. Plastic bags are confiscated at the same counter.

The visa, which is genuinely simple

The Rwanda Development Board states it in one sentence: citizens of all countries are allowed to get a visa upon arrival without prior application.

  • African Union, Commonwealth and Francophonie member countries: 30 days, free. That covers most of Europe's Francophone countries, the whole Commonwealth including the UK, Australia, Canada, India, Malaysia and Singapore, and all of Africa.
  • East African Community citizens get a pass free of charge for a six month stay.
  • Ninety days free for Angola, Benin, Central African Republic, Chad, Cote d'Ivoire, Ghana, Guinea, Haiti, Indonesia, Mauritius, Philippines, Qatar, Saint Kitts and Nevis, Sao Tome and Principe, Senegal, Seychelles, Sierra Leone and Singapore.
  • Everyone else pays, and the fee is capped: no more than USD 50 for single entry, USD 70 for multiple.
  • You can apply online first if you prefer, and pay online or on arrival. There is no affiliated agent authorised to apply on your behalf, whatever a search result tells you.

The passport

  • Valid at least 6 months after the day you arrive, with at least one blank page for stamps.

Yellow fever

  • A certificate is required if you are arriving from a country on the transmission risk list, which includes much of central and west Africa. A long transit through one can count.

The plastic bag

  • Rwanda bans single-use plastic bags and confiscates them on arrival. This is not a fine or a warning; the bag is taken at the airport.
  • Repack before you fly. Duty free bags, packing bags, bin liners inside a suitcase - all of it.
  • The airport-security resealable liquids bag is the usual exception, but do not build a plan around exceptions.

The East Africa Tourist Visa

  • USD 100 covers Kenya, Rwanda and Uganda for 90 days with multiple entries. Worth it if you are crossing more than one border; otherwise the free 30 days is better.
